Abstract

The invention provides a liquid treatment and transmission device for medical examination and a method thereof, and relates to the technical field of medical examination. The liquid treatment and transmission device for medical examination comprises a bottom plate, wherein the upper surface of the bottom plate is fixedly connected with a box body, the right side of the bottom plate, which is positioned on the box body, is fixedly connected with a side plate, the left side of the side plate is provided with a placing plate, the upper surface of the placing plate is provided with a placing groove, the inside of the placing groove is provided with a medicament bottle, and the lower surface of the placing plate is provided with a first moving mechanism; the inside of the box body is provided with a transfer mechanism. Through this structure, can be automatic transfer the medicament in the medicament bottle to other medicament bottles in, need not artifical manual transfer to utilize the conveyer belt to carry the medicament that finishes transferring, carry appointed position with it, also need not artifical manual taking put, avoid the manual phenomenon that takes place to drop when taking put, improve the practicality of device.

Technical Field
The invention relates to the technical field of medical examination, in particular to a liquid treatment and transmission device and a liquid treatment and transmission method for medical examination.
Background
The medical examination field sometimes requires such operations: the first step of injecting the liquid (possibly the liquid composed of the mixture) into the centrifuge, not for the purpose of centrifugal stratification, but for the purpose of mixing or applying a certain pressure to the liquid, the second step of allowing the liquid to be treated in the centrifuge first, the third step of sucking the liquid from the centrifuge, the fourth step of injecting the liquid sucked in the third step into another container, the fifth step of transferring the position of the liquid.
When transferring the liquid medicine, most all are personnel manual with the liquid transfer, but personnel very easily lead to the phenomenon that the liquid medicine spills when manual transfer, and the personnel is when taking the liquid medicine at the same time, at the in-process of walking, also can lead to the liquid medicine to spill because of other factors, just so lead to the liquid medicine extravagant very easily.

Detailed Description
The following description of the embodiments of the present invention will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present invention,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the invention without making any inventive effort, are intended to be within the scope of the invention.
As shown in fig. 1-5, the embodiment of the invention provides a liquid treatment and transmission device for medical examination and a method thereof, which comprises a bottom plate 1, wherein the upper surface of the bottom plate 1 is fixedly connected with a box body 2, the upper surface of the bottom plate 1 is fixedly connected with a side plate 3 positioned on the right side of the box body 2, the left side of the side plate 3 is provided with a placement plate 7, the upper surface of the placement plate 7 is provided with a placement groove 8, the upper end edge of the placement groove 8 is provided with a rounding corner, a medicament bottle 9 is convenient to be easily placed in the placement groove 8, the interior of the placement groove 8 is provided with the medicament bottle 9, the lower surface of the placement plate 7 is provided with a first moving mechanism, the first moving mechanism comprises a motor 4, the motor 4 is arranged on the right side surface of the side plate 3, a screw 5 is movably connected with the side plate 3, the lower surface of the first moving block 6 is slidingly connected with the bottom plate 1, the output end of the motor 4 is fixedly connected with a screw 5, the side surface of the screw 5 is in threaded connection with a moving block 6, and the upper surface of the moving block 6 is fixedly connected with the lower surface of the placement plate 7.
The inside of box 2 is provided with transfer mechanism, transfer mechanism includes fixed plate 14, the lower surface fixedly connected with electric putter one 15 of fixed plate 14, electric putter one 15's output fixedly connected with lifter plate 16, lifter plate 16's medial surface fixedly connected with syringe 17, lifter plate 16's upper surface fixedly connected with riser 18, fixedly connected with diaphragm 19 between two risers 18, diaphragm 19's medial surface fixedly connected with electric putter two 20, electric putter two 20's output shaft and syringe 17's piston handle fixed connection, syringe 17's position is in same horizontal direction with the position of medicament bottle 9.
The upper surface of fixed plate 14 is provided with moving mechanism two, and it just includes mounting panel 10 to remove, and the lateral surface fixedly connected with symmetrical arrangement's of mounting panel 10 motor two 11, the output fixedly connected with screw rod two 12 of motor two 11, the lateral surface threaded connection of screw rod two 12 has spacing slider 13, and mounting panel 10 installs the upper surface at box 2, spacing slider 13 and box 2 sliding connection guarantee spacing negligence 13 stability when removing.
The upper surface of bottom plate 1 and be in the left side of box 2 are provided with conveying mechanism, conveying mechanism includes backup pad 21, backup pad 21 installs the upper surface at bottom plate 1, and roller 23 rotates the medial surface of connecting in two backup pads 21, and the left surface fixedly connected with motor three 22 of backup pad 21, the output fixedly connected with roller 23 of motor three 22, the side surface transmission of roller 23 is connected with conveyer belt 24, and storage cylinder 25 sets up the upper surface at conveyer belt 24, and conveying mechanism's upper surface is provided with storage cylinder 25.
A method for liquid handling, delivery for medical testing, comprising one of the above liquid handling, delivery devices for medical testing, comprising the steps of:
s1, placing the liquid medicine taken out of a centrifugal machine into a medicine bottle 9, placing the medicine bottle 9 into a placing groove 8 on a placing plate 7, driving a moving block I6 to move through a motor I4, and moving the placing plate 7 outside a box body 2 into the box body 2;
s2, driving the injection cylinder 17 on the lifting plate 16 to move downwards through the first electric push rod 15, enabling a needle on the injection cylinder 17 to extend into the medicament bottle 9, driving a piston handle on the injection cylinder 17 to move upwards through the second electric push rod 20, and sucking the medicament liquid in the medicament bottle 9 into the injection cylinder 17;
s3, driving a screw rod II 12 to rotate through a motor II 11, moving the injection cylinder 17 to the left side of the box body 2 through a limit sliding block 13, and pushing a piston handle through an electric push rod II 20 to transfer the medicament in the injection cylinder 17 into a storage cylinder 25 on a conveying belt 24;
s4, driving the rotary roller 23 to rotate through the motor III 22, and moving the storage cylinder 25 to a designated position through the transmission of the conveyor belt 24, so that a person can take the storage cylinder off the storage cylinder.
Working principle: the medicine liquid taken out from the centrifugal machine is put into the medicine bottle 9, then the medicine bottle 9 is put into the placing groove 8 on the placing plate 7, the first screw rod 5 is driven to rotate by the first motor 4, the first moving block 6 is driven to move by the first screw rod 5, the placing plate 7 outside the box body 2 can be moved into the box body 2 by sliding the first moving block 6 and the bottom plate 1, and the medicine bottle 9 is positioned right below the injection cylinder 17;
then the first electric push rod 15 drives the injection cylinder 17 on the lifting plate 16 to move downwards, so that the needle head on the injection cylinder 17 stretches into the medicament bottle 9, and the second electric push rod 20 drives the piston handle on the injection cylinder 17 to move upwards, so that the medicament liquid in the medicament bottle 9 can be sucked into the injection cylinder 17;
the second motor 11 drives the second screw 12 to rotate, the injection cylinder 17 can be moved to the left side of the box body 2 through the limit sliding block 13, the injection cylinder 17 is positioned right above the storage cylinder 25, and the second electric push rod 20 pushes the piston handle to transfer the medicament in the injection cylinder 17 into the storage cylinder 25 on the conveying belt 24;
and the third motor 22 drives the rotary roller 23 to rotate, and the storage cylinder 25 can be moved to a designated position through the transmission of the conveying belt 24, so that a person can take the storage cylinder off the storage cylinder.
